Average annual temperature: 57°F (14°C)

Florence enjoys a mild Mediterranean climate, with an average annual temperature of 57°F (14°C). This means that the city experiences relatively mild winters and warm summers, making it a pleasant place to visit year-round.

  • Warm summers:

    Summer temperatures in Florence average between 75°F (24°C) and 90°F (32°C). The hottest months are July and August, when temperatures can reach up to 100°F (38°C) on occasion. However, the city's low humidity levels make the heat more bearable.

  • Mild winters:

    Winter temperatures in Florence average between 40°F (4°C) and 50°F (10°C). The coldest month is January, when temperatures can drop below freezing. However, snow is rare in Florence, and the city typically experiences only a few days of frost each year.

  • Pleasant spring and autumn:

    Spring and autumn in Florence are mild and pleasant, with average temperatures ranging from 50°F (10°C) to 75°F (24°C). These seasons are ideal for outdoor activities, such as walking, biking, and sightseeing.

Rainfall spread throughout the year

Florence receives rainfall throughout the year, with an average annual precipitation of 33 inches (840 mm). The rain is spread fairly evenly throughout the year, with no pronounced wet or dry season.

  • Rainy season:

    The rainiest months in Florence are October and November, when the city receives an average of 4 inches (100 mm) of rain per month. However, even during these months, the rain is usually short-lived and doesn't interfere with outdoor activities.

  • Dry season:

    The driest months in Florence are July and August, when the city receives an average of 1 inch (25 mm) of rain per month. However, even during these months, there can be occasional showers.

Plan indoor activities for rainy days:
Even though Florence has mild weather year-round, there can be occasional rainy days. To make the most of your trip, plan some indoor activities for these days. Some popular indoor attractions in Florence include the Uffizi Gallery, the Accademia Gallery, and the Palazzo Pitti.

Take advantage of the shoulder seasons:
The shoulder seasons (spring and autumn) are a great time to visit Florence if you want to avoid the crowds and high prices of the summer months. The weather is still mild and pleasant during these seasons, making it ideal for outdoor activities like walking, biking, and sightseeing.

Be prepared for crowds in the summer:
Florence is a popular tourist destination, so it can get crowded in the summer months. If you are visiting Florence during this time, be prepared for long lines and large crowds at popular attractions. One way to avoid the crowds is to visit early in the morning or late in the evening.
